一个质量为1 kg的物体从离地面高5 m处自由下落,不计空气阻力,重力加速度取10 m/s²。求物体落地时的动能。

Principle or equation
机械能守恒定律:自由下落过程中,只有重力做功,机械能守恒。落地时动能等于初始重力势能,Ek = mgh。
Why this answer is correct
初始动能为零,重力势能 Ep = mgh = 1×10×5 = 50 J。落地时重力势能为零,动能等于初始重力势能,即 Ek = 50 J。
Example
若质量为2 kg,高度为10 m,则落地动能 = 2×10×10 = 200 J。
